This is crunch time for these two sides as the Mzansi Super League goes into the Eliminator stage today, with the winner meeting Cape Town Blitz in the Final on Sunday at Newlands, Cape Town.

Both teams are studded with talent. Let’s have a look at the two squads.

Jozi Stars: Kagiso Rabada, Chris Gayle, Dane Vilas, Rassie van der Dussen, Daniel Christian, Beuran Hendricks, Reeza Hendricks, Dwaine Pretorius, Eddie Leie, Petrus van Biljon, Duanne Olivier, Ryan Rickelton, Sinethemba Qeshile, Simon Harmer, Calvin Savage , Shimane Alfred Mothoa

Paarl Rocks: Faf du Plessis, Dwayne Bravo, Tabraiz Shamsi, Dane Paterson, Aiden Markram, Mangaliso Mosehle, Bjorn Fortuin, Vaughn van Jaarsveld, Grant Thomson, Tshepo Moreki, Henry Davids, Eathan Bosch, Patrick Kruger, Kerwin Mungroo, David Wiese, Michael Klinger

Chris Gayle is not available for the Jozi Stars, however, they have plenty of batting power in Rassie van der Dussen, Reeza Hendricks, Daniel Christian and Dane Vilas and a bowling line match with Kagiso Rabada, Beuran Hendricks and leading wicket taker Duanne Olivier. For Paarl Rocks, Faf du Plessis, Aiden Markram and David Wiese will be the mainstay of the batting and Dwayne Bravo the star with the ball.
